There are four main types of hydropower projects. These technologies can often overlap. For example, storage projects can often involve an element of pumping to supplement the water that flows into the reservoir naturally, and run-of-river projects may provide some storage capability. Web25 dec. 2014 · Hydro electric power plant Schematic Diagram: Although a hydro electric power station simply involves the conversion of hydraulic energy into electrical energy, … Web12 okt. 2024 · A 5kW hydroelectric turbine with constant water head and flow will potentially generate: 5kWh x 8760 hours (in a year) = 43800 kWh. For comparison, a 5kWh solar panel system would generate approximately: 5kWh x 1825 (peak-sun-hours per year) = 9125 kWh. In theory, a home hydro power system far out-performs solar, even …

WebPut very simply, hydroelectric power is generated using flowing water to spin a turbine. This turns a shaft that’s connected to an electric generator. More often than not, hydroelectric dams are used to direct the water downward through the turbine in a way which can be controlled to maximise energy production.
